HorizonCraft continues to grow, not only through its activities on the ground, but also in the way it connects people, shares knowledge, and builds a transnational community.

As part of its commitment to transparency, collaboration, and impact, the project has recently activated new digital communication and data-sharing tools, with a dedicated Facebook page and a LinkedIn group. These virtual spaces are designed to support a more dynamic exchange between partners, stakeholders, and the wider public, creating a space where information can circulate more freely and opportunities can reach a broader audience.

The new social channels play a strategic role in disseminating project results and updates in real time, while also fostering engagement among young people, micro, small and medium-sized enterprises, and stakeholders across the Euro-Mediterranean region. In a project that connects partners in Italy, Lebanon, and Egypt, communication becomes a central pillar, enabling coordination, participation, and the building of lasting relationships beyond the project’s duration.

Within this framework, the new communication tools are not simply channels for visibility, but instruments that reinforce the project’s impact. By making information more accessible and encouraging interaction, they help connect local experiences with a wider international context, amplifying the reach of HorizonCraft’s actions and results.
